“…Plasma-molecular effects result in a significantly enhanced population of the hydrogen atom n = 3 state, which may have implications for the treatment of photon opacity to the Lyman series in simulations [58,59] as well as the diagnosis of photon opacity [7]. Accounting for molecular ions in the analysis of hydrogen atomic line emission required the creation of novel analysis techniques [6,15,16], which need to be further expanded to include photon opacity effects.…”
